On Wed, Oct 09, 2019 at 09:26:01AM +0100, Cristian Marussi wrote:
> Add some arm64/signal specific boilerplate and utility code to help
> further testcases' development.
>
> Introduce also one simple testcase mangle_pstate_invalid_compat_toggle
> and some related helpers: it is a simple mangle testcase which messes
> with the ucontext_t from within the signal handler, trying to toggle
> PSTATE state bits to switch the system between 32bit/64bit execution
> state. Expects SIGSEGV on test PASS.

> diff --git a/tools/testing/selftests/arm64/signal/.gitignore b/tools/testing/selftests/arm64/signal/.gitignore
> new file mode 100644
> index 000000000000..e5aeae45febb
> --- /dev/null
> +++ b/tools/testing/selftests/arm64/signal/.gitignore
> @@ -0,0 +1,3 @@
> +!*.[ch]
> +mangle_*
> +fake_sigreturn_*
I think the !*.[ch] line needs to come last.
Re-including *.[ch] on the first line has no effect because no files
have been excluded yet.
(This looks like it was my mistake when I originally suggested using
wildcards here -- apologies for that!)
